What is the PE Passport?
A comprehensive Physical Education planning, assessment, evidencing and tracking platform designed to enable all school teachers to deliver enjoyable and active lessons. The PE Passport is written and designed by primary school teachers and leaders with PE specialism and years of experience of teaching PE.
Our PE schemes of work with engaging, interactive PE lesson plans for each year group are included with each lesson containing clear, progressive learning objectives; differentiated activities and videos to support the narrative.
Teachers can quickly assess and monitor the progress of each individual child, whilst coordinators can track children’s participation and progress in extra-curricular clubs, events and competitions.

An excellent use of the PE and Sport Premium
You’ll be achieving all five of the PE and Sports Premium Key Indicators with a PE Passport Subscription. GOV.uk Guidance
1 - Increased confidence, knowledge and skills of all staff in teaching PE and sport
The full PE scheme of work contains teaching points and key questions to assist in delivery of high quality lessons as well as full instructional diagrams and skill videos. We also provide an ongoing virtual CPD programme and unlimited support in using the platform.
2 - Engagement of all pupils in regular physical activity
The ability to track and report on all areas of Physical Education, School Sport and Physical Activity allows for regular monitoring and progress checking. Plus with additional resources and supporting materials, teachers have access to many intervention activities.
3 - The profile of PE and sport is raised across the school as a tool for whole school improvement
With a unique reporting matrix all pupils can be assessed, tracked and analysed across a number of areas creating an environment for pupils to strive to make improvements and progress in an number of key areas.
4 - Broader experience of a range of sports and physical activities offered to all pupils
Our PE scheme of work covers the whole of the PE National Curriculum incorporating traditional areas such as Football, Basketball (Invasion Games), Cricket (Striking and Fielding), Dance and Gymnastics. The PE scheme of work also has a broader range of activities such as Ultimate Frisbee, Leadership and Lacrosse.
5 - Increased participation in competitive sport
Within the Extra Curricular and Events sections all participation data is recorded and can be analysed across schools. Any potential gaps can be identified utilising the filter function as well as also recording links with external agencies and providers.
